
拓海先生、最近部下が「制御即興」という論文を引き合いに出してきまして、どう役に立つのか全然ピンと来ないのです。これって要するに何に使えるんでしょうか。

素晴らしい着眼点ですね!端的に言うと、過去の行動データを学習して、ランダム性を保ちながらも安全性やルールを満たす制御パターンを自動で作れるんですよ。つまり意図的に“ばらつき”をつけつつルール違反はしない動きを生み出せるんです。

なるほど。うちで言えば、夜間の照明の入切パターンを真似して、防犯のためにランダムに動かすといった話に使えるのですか。

まさにその通りです。家庭の照明を例に取ると、過去のスイッチ操作データから分布を学習し、夜間に自然に見えるけれど予測困難なオンオフを生成できます。要点は三つです。過去データを使うこと、ルール(ハード制約)を必ず守ること、そして一部は確率的に守る(ソフト制約)ことができる点です。

投資対効果の観点で聞きたいのですが、データが足りない場合やモデルが外れるリスクはどうするんですか。現場は昔からの習慣が強いので心配です。

大丈夫、焦る必要はありませんよ。まずは既存のログからモデルを作り、それを検証ツールでチェックします。検証では形式的な言い方で「このルールは常に守られるか」を調べられます。投資対効果を見たいなら、段階的に導入して試験運用し、実測で効果を確かめるのが現実的です。

検証ツールというのは専門的なソフトですか。運用担当者が扱えるものなのか心配です。

検証に使うのはPRISMというツールで、これはモデル検証(Model Checking)を行うソフトです。使い方は専門家が最初に設定し、その結果を運用側へ分かりやすいレポートとして渡す流れが現実的です。要は専門家が土台を作り、実務は結果を見て判断できれば十分です。

これって要するに、過去のデータを学ばせてから「やってはいけないこと」は絶対守らせつつ、「なるほど、らしく見える」動きをランダムに作る、ということですか。

その通りですよ。簡潔にまとめると三点です。まずデータに基づく生成、次にハード制約の厳守、最後にソフト制約の確率的な満足です。これを満たすアルゴリズムを用意してから、現場に合うように微調整していきます。

現場での調整や微調整は誰がやるべきですか。うちの現場はベテランが多いので、彼らの経験とどう結びつけるかが鍵だと思いますが。

現場の知見は極めて重要です。最初は技術側が基礎モデルと検証を行い、その結果を現場のベテランと一緒に見ながらルールを微修正します。運用開始後もログを回収して定期的に再学習・再検証する運用が望ましいです。「一度で完成」ではなく「改善し続ける」が成功のコツですよ。

分かりました。自分の言葉で言うと、過去の振る舞いを真似しつつ、安全基準は守るランダムな動作生成法を作って、それを検証ツールで確かめながら現場の知見で調整していく、ということですね。まずは小さく試して報告します。
概要と位置づけ
結論から述べる。本研究が示した最も大きな貢献は、過去の振る舞いを学習した確率的生成モデルに対して、時間的な確率仕様を課して「安全でらしく見える」制御シーケンスを自動生成できる点である。すなわち、単に過去を再現するだけでなく、守るべき制約(ハード制約)を常時満たしつつ、満たすべきだが多少の違反を許容する制約(ソフト制約)を確率的に管理できる運用が実現可能になった。これは単純なログ再生や固定ルールベースでは得られない、柔軟性と安全性の両立を意味する。
基礎的には、時系列データから生成モデルを学び、それを形式的検証ツールで確認するというワークフローに依拠する。生成側は明示持続時間付き隠れマルコフモデル(Explicit-Duration Hidden Markov Model; EDHMM)を活用し、検証側は確率的計算木論理(Probabilistic Computation Tree Logic; PCTL)により時間的制約を表現している。応用面では、家庭の照明制御など日常的なデバイスの振る舞い模倣に適用され、防犯や省エネの実効的な運用が期待できる。
本研究は学術的には制御即興(Control Improvisation; CI)の枠組みと結びつく。CIはもともと自動機理論の文脈で定義された問題であり、ここではデータ駆動型の確率モデルと正式仕様の統合により実践的な制御生成を目指している。企業の運用に置き換えれば、現場の運転パターンを尊重しつつ安全基準を形式的に担保する仕組みと捉えられる。
本節を総括すると、従来の単純な再生やルール適用に比べ、学習→検証→生成という流れで確率的制御を安全に導入できる点がこの論文の位置づけである。短期的にはデバイス制御やホームオートメーション、長期的には人間と機械が混在する複雑なネットワーク制御に有効である。
先行研究との差別化ポイント
従来研究は大別すると、過去データの単純模倣と形式的手法による厳密制御に分かれる。単純模倣は現場の「らしさ」は再現できるが安全性の担保に乏しく、形式的手法は安全性は高いが現場適合性に欠ける。本研究の差別化点はこの両者を統合し、データ由来の柔軟性と形式仕様由来の安全性を同時に満たす点である。これは現場導入の現実的ハードルを下げる意義がある。
技術的には、学習モデルとしてEDHMMを採用する点が特徴である。EDHMMは観測可能な状態に対して明示的に「その状態が継続する時間」をモデル化できるため、オン・オフの持続時間が意味を持つシステムに適している。これによって単に状態遷移の確率だけでなく時間的な性質まで模倣可能になり、照明などの典型的応用に強みが出る。
検証手法としてPCTLを用いる点も差別化要因である。PCTLは時間と確率を同時に扱え、例えば「ある時間帯におけるある事象が発生する確率が閾値以下であること」を形式的に表現できる。これにより、運用上の許容リスクを数値で明確化し、生成モデルがその基準を満たすかどうかを判定できる。
さらに本研究は、単なる理論提示に留まらず実装とケーススタディまで示している点で実務寄りである。住宅の照明制御を事例に、学習→モデル化→検証→生成という一連のワークフローを示し、実運用で求められる調整やヒューリスティックの導入まで踏み込んでいる。
中核となる技術的要素
本研究の技術的中核は三つある。第一にデータ駆動の生成モデルであるEDHMMだ。EDHMM(Explicit-Duration Hidden Markov Model; EDHMM)は状態の持続時間分布を明示的に扱い、単に瞬間的な遷移確率だけでなく各状態に滞在する長さの特性を学習する。これにより照明の「長く点いている」「短く点く」といった時間的パターンを忠実に再現できる。
第二に、生成する確率分布に対する制約表現としてのPCTL(Probabilistic Computation Tree Logic; PCTL)である。PCTLは「ある時間範囲内で事象が起きる確率がp以上/以下である」といった表現を可能にし、ハード制約とソフト制約の両方を形式的に定義できる。これにより生成物が運用上の要求を満たすかを一律に検証できる。
第三に、モデル検証ツールであるPRISMを介した実装途上のワークフローである。EDHMMは一旦マルコフ連鎖としてエンコードされ、PRISMに入力される。PRISMはPCTL仕様に対しモデル検査を行い、満足確率を計算する。必要に応じてモデルのパラメータを補完・補正し、仕様を満たすように候補を生成する工程が組み込まれている。
これらの要素をつなぐのが制御即興(Control Improvisation; CI)の枠組みである。CIはハード制約を常に守らせ、同時に出力分布の偏りを抑えるための乱択性を確保するという問題定義を与える。具体的には出力分布の支持集合や最大確率を制約しつつ、ソフト制約の満足確率を管理する仕組みが実装されている。
有効性の検証方法と成果
検証は住宅内の照明使用ログをケーススタディとして行われた。手順はデータ収集、EDHMMによるパラメータ学習、学習モデルのマルコフ化、PRISMでのPCTLモデル検査、そして生成器(Improviser)の評価という一連の流れである。評価ではハード制約の不変性とソフト制約の満足確率を定量的に測定し、実運用に耐えるかを判定している。
成果として、学習モデルに基づく生成器は元データと類似した時間的特徴を保持しつつ、設定したPCTL仕様を満たすことが確認された。特にソフト制約については、ヒューリスティックなキャリブレーション(Duration-Calibrated、Transition-Calibratedなど)を適用することで満足確率を向上させる手法が有効であった。
また、モデル検査により出力分布の偏りや特定パターンの過剰頻度を早期に発見できる点が実用上の収穫である。これにより運用者は「どの確率仕様を厳しくするべきか」を定量的に判断でき、費用対効果の高い調整が可能になる。
結果は実用性の観点でポジティブであるが、学習データの偏りや未知の外れ値に対する頑健性は限定的であり、運用段階での継続的な監視と再学習が不可欠であるという結論になった。
研究を巡る議論と課題
まずデータ品質の問題がある。学習に用いるログが偏っていると生成モデルは偏った行動を再現してしまい、安全性検証も形骸化する恐れがある。したがって導入前にデータ収集方法を見直し、代表性の高いサンプルを確保する必要がある。次に計算資源と専門家の投入コストである。
PRISM等によるモデル検査は強力だが、複雑モデルの検査は計算負荷が高くなる。実務導入では専門チームによる初期設定や定期的な再検証が必要であり、人件費と時間的コストが生じる。これを低減するための近似手法や運用ルールの確立が今後の課題だ。
さらに、人間との協調という観点も議論の対象である。生成されるランダム性が現場の運用感覚と乖離すると不信感を生むため、ベテランの知見を反映するためのヒューマン・イン・ザ・ループの設計が重要だ。技術は現場を置き去りにしてはいけない。
最後に法的・倫理的側面である。住宅やサービスの振る舞いを模倣する際、プライバシーや利用者の同意に配慮する必要がある。特に取得するデータの管理と利用範囲を明確にし、運用ポリシーを策定することが不可欠である。
今後の調査・学習の方向性
まず実務的な課題としては、少データ下での頑健な学習法と低コストな検証ワークフローの確立が求められる。これには転移学習や領域適応、簡易化された検査プロトコルの研究が寄与するだろう。次に現場適合性を高めるための操作性の改善だ。
現場で使いやすいダッシュボードや、ベテランが直感的にルールを調整できるインターフェースの整備が重要である。技術的にはEDHMM以外の生成モデルとの比較や、PCTL以外の確率時間的仕様との互換性検討も価値がある。実デプロイでの長期評価が次段階の鍵となる。
研究コミュニティ向けの検索キーワードを挙げる。Control Improvisation, Explicit-Duration Hidden Markov Model, Probabilistic Computation Tree Logic, PRISM, Data-driven Controller Synthesis。これらの英語キーワードで文献検索すれば関連研究がたどりやすい。
会議で使えるフレーズ集
「この提案は過去ログを尊重しつつ、安全基準を形式的に担保する点が強みです。」
「まず実証フェーズで小規模に試して、ログを基に再学習する運用設計にしましょう。」
「検証はPRISMで行い、満足確率を可視化して意思決定に使えます。」


